The 2024 Fordham Rams football team represented Fordham University as a member of the Patriot League during the 2024 NCAA Division I FCS football season. They were led by 7th-year head coach Joe Conlin , and played their home games at Coffey Field in The Bronx .

The 2022 Fordham Rams football team represented Fordham University as a member of the Patriot League during the 2022 NCAA Division I FCS football season. Led by fifth-year head coach Joe Conlin , the Rams compiled an overall record of 9–3 with a mark of 5–1 in conference play, placing second in the Patriot League.
The 2021 Fordham Rams football team represented Fordham University as a member of the Patriot League during the 2021 NCAA Division I FCS football season. Led by fourth-year head coach Joe Conlin , the Rams compiled an overall record of 6–5 with a mark of 4–2 in conference play, placing third in the Patriot League.

Other milestones for the Rams included a 34–7 win over little-known Waynesburg to start the 1939 season. That contest was famous for being the first televised college football game. Fordham, which had previously suspended football during the 1943-1945 seasons due to World War II, dropped the program entirely following the 1954 season. Tim DeMorat (born October 18, 1999) is an American professional football quarterback who is a free agent.He played college football for the Fordham Rams, where he was a three-time Patriot League Offensive Player of the Year and named a FCS All-American in 2022.
